Paspampres Explains Armed Woman Incident Nearby Presidential Palace

25 October 2022 13:02 WIB

A woman was arrested for pointing a gun at the Indonesian Presidential Guard (Paspampres). Photo: Special Source

TEMPO.CO, Jakarta - The commander of the Presidential Security Detail (Paspampres), vice marshal Wahyu Hidayat Soedjatmiko on Tuesday clarified details about the arrest of a woman who approached the Presidential Palace complex in Central Jakarta armed with a handgun. 

According to Wahyu, what was initially reported as a breach was not true. “It was actually because of our personnel’s vigilance,” he said in a statement on October 25.

As reported earlier, a woman wearing a niqab was arrested in front of the State Palace in Jakarta. She was carrying a silver semi-automatic FN pistol.

Adj. Comr. Pol. Linda, the deputy chief of Central Jakarta Police's Satuan Lalu Lintas, confirmed the incident and said that the woman was acting on her own.

One member of the Presidential Security Detail observed the suspicious behavior shown by the woman who was standing nearby the Paspampres post in front of the President’s palace. Personnel immediately approached the person and responded with the woman pointing the handgun toward the Paspampres. 

Three police officers immediately apprehended the woman, said to be around 25 years old, and took away the gun. The woman has been handed over to the police for questioning. The gun has been confiscated as evidence along with other items in her effect: a Quran, an empty wallet, and a mobile gadget.
